  • Blake Ferguson: Released by Miami

    The Dolphins released Ferguson on Thursday. The 28-year-old long snapped appeared in just five regular-season games for Miami last season due to an illness that landed him on the reserve/NFI list. Ferguson has 72 career games of experience under his belt and will look to latch on elsewhere.

  • Dolphins' Blake Ferguson: Will remain on NFI list

    Ferguson (illness) will remain on the reserve/non-football injury list. The Dolphins' 21-day window to activate Ferguson off the NFI list has now expired, thus ending his season. He will now focus on getting healthy for the 2025 campaign.

  • Dolphins' Blake Ferguson: On verge of return

    Ferguson (personal) was designated to return from the reserve/non-football illness list Wednesday, David Furones of the South Florida Sun Sentinel reports. Ferguson has been on the list since Oct. 19, but it appears his time there may be ending soon. He'll now have a 21-day window to practice with the team before needing to be placed on the active roster, which could happen in time to return Sunday against the Jets.
